no, i think we have always had a mix of la masia/reserve team players even when the team as a whole wasn't in financial difficulties. remember that mapi was the first transfer in spanish women's football when we brought her in from atletí for €50,000 back in 2017. and we bought keira from manchester city in 2022 for a world-record fee around £350,000. so it's not like we are afraid of spending on big players.
but where barça had success was not simply relying on foreign players but in elevating players from the b team to the first team as well. and some of our best all time players are homegrown talent. again, it's about balance. and that's what has led to success for barça.
yeah, it's an interesting situation because there are no max caps for these teams (outside of nwsl, afaik), and i can't imagine all of a sudden we start imposing our own financial fair play style rules in the future. at some point the market has to correct itself if it becomes only a handful of teams that are able to spend at that level. only time will tell...

Covid-19: FIFA Suggests Player Contracts And Transfer Windows Be Changed
An internal FIFA document, presented to its coronavirus working group, is suggesting current contracts for players and coaches should be extended until the end of the delayed domestic football seasons.
The confidential document also recommends allowing transfer windows to be changed in accordance with new season dates. It also urges clubs and players to work together to find solutions to salary…
